1. Power Troubles? Check the Easy‑Access Driver Compartment First

When your mirror doesn’t light up, a good first step is to locate the easy-access driver compartment—most modern units include a dedicated panel for servicing the LED driver. Start by confirming power availability and tight electrical connections. Flickering or failure to power may point to a driver issue, easily resolvable by replacing that module alone, without disturbing the rest of the mirror.



2. Burning Out Too Quickly: Faulty LED Panels vs. Dirt

LEDs should last for years, but if colors fade early or spots flicker out, the standardized LED panel might need replacement. Since many models maintain compatibility with off-the-shelf strips, you can likely source replacements without waiting for specific parts. However, always inspect and clean gently—sometimes, dimming is caused by moisture or residue buildup obstructing the lighting elements.

3. Fogging Fails? Troubleshoot the Modular Anti‑Fog Heating System

If the mirror fogs up, the heating element likely lost power or adhesion. The modular anti-fog heating system—usually a slim pad behind the glass—can often be accessed and replaced via a back panel. Carefully follow the manufacturer’s guide, ensuring adhesive areas are clean and self-heating components remain dry.

4. Non-Responsive Controls: Think Sensor Calibration First

Touch or motion-sensitive controls can glitch, but you don’t always need a full component swap. Try resetting the cabinet by power cycling, then retest sensor response. Many systems include a recalibration mode inside the housing, making this a low-effort fix before replacing sensor hardware.

5. Water Damage? Moisture-Proof Design Helps Maintenance

Even with IP-rated design, water can seep in. If internal fogging or residue appears, remove the outer frame, dry thoroughly, and clean components. Re-apply silicone sealant if needed. Thanks to maintenance-friendly enclosures, this repair is manageable without disrupting electrical systems.



6. When Professional Help Is Warranted

If fault isolations like power issues, deep wiring faults, or glass damage arise, consult a licensed electrician. Attempting complex electrical repairs without proper training can be dangerous—especially when waterproof electrical seals are compromised. In such cases, professional inspection is your safest bet.

8. Preventative Care Reduces Repair Frequency

Routine maintenance—wiping the mirror surface with a microfiber cloth, avoiding harsh cleaning agents, and ensuring proper ventilation—can prolong the life of the anti-fog system and LED components. Also, inspecting seals quarterly helps catch potential issues before they evolve.
